Job Description

We're looking for a detail-oriented and compassionate Research Study Assistant III to join our Sleep Center in Novi, United States. In this role, you will provide essential support to our research team by coordinating sleep studies, managing patient interactions, and maintaining accurate documentation. You will play a vital part in ensuring the smooth operation of our clinical research initiatives while maintaining the highest standards of professionalism, compliance, and patient care. Your organizational skills, empathetic approach, and commitment to excellence will directly contribute to advancing sleep medicine research and improving patient outcomes.

  • Coordinate and schedule sleep study appointments with efficiency, ensuring optimal patient flow and resource allocation
  • Collect, record, and manage patient data with meticulous attention to detail, adhering to all HIPAA regulations and research protocols
  • Assist in the setup, monitoring, and maintenance of polysomnography (PSG) equipment, ensuring proper calibration and functionality
  • Conduct patient intake interviews, obtain informed consent, and explain study procedures in a clear, supportive, and empathetic manner
  • Maintain comprehensive and organized study documentation, including patient files, consent forms, and research records with accuracy and precision
  • Monitor patient compliance with study protocols and follow up on any deviations or concerns in a timely and professional mannerPrepare study materials, equipment, and patient rooms prior to scheduled appointments, ensuring all resources are readily accessible
  • Assist with data entry into electronic health records (EHR) and research databases with accuracy and efficiency, maintaining data integrity
  • Support the research team with administrative tasks, including scheduling, correspondence, report preparation, and general coordination
  • Communicate effectively with patients, physicians, and research staff to address questions, resolve issues, and foster collaborative relationships
  • Ensure all study materials and equipment are properly organized, maintained, and readily accessible for team members
  • Participate in ongoing training to maintain current knowledge of sleep medicine protocols, research best practices, and regulatory requirements
  • Demonstrate flexibility and adaptability in a fast-paced clinical research environment while maintaining attention to detail
  • Prioritize patient safety and well-being in all interactions and study-related activities
Qualifications

**Required Qualifications:**

  • Proven experience in clinical research coordination, patient support roles, or related healthcare settings
  • Strong organizational and time management skills with demonstrated ability to manage multiple studies simultaneously
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ills with the ability to interact professionally with diverse stakeholders
  • Proficiency with electronic health records (EHR) systems and research databases
  • Demonstrated ability to maintain accurate, detailed, and organized documentation
  • Comprehensive knowledge of HIPAA regulations and unwavering commitment to patient confidentiality
  • Ability to work collaboratively with healthcare professionals, physicians, and research teams
  • Strong attention to detail with a commitment to data accuracy and integrity
  • Professional demeanor with the ability to interact compassionately and empathetically with patients
  • Problem-solving skills and ability to address challenges proactively
  • Flexibility and adaptability in a dynamic clinical research environment
Preferred Qualifications
  • Prior experience working in a sleep center or clinical research environment
  • Knowledge of polysomnography (PSG) procedures and sleep medicine terminology
  • Phlebotomy certification or hands-on experience with patient specimen collection
  • Experience with research data management systems and analytical tools
  • Customer service experience in a healthcare setting
  • Familiarity with clinical research protocols and regulatory requirements
  • Certification as a Clinical Research Coordinator (CCRP) or equivalent credential
  • Experience with patient scheduling systems and appointment management software
  • Understanding of sleep disorders and sleep medicine principles
